abstract

  • We present ACXESS (Access Control for XML with Enhanced Security Specifications), a system for specifying and enforcing enhanced security constraints on XML via virtual "security views" and query rewrites. ACXESS is the first system that bears the capability to specify and enforce complicated security policies on both subtrees and structural relationships. © 2006 IEEE.
